免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

百度小程序开发源码出售

百度小程序是一种基于百度开放能力的小程序平台,它允许开发者使用HTML、CSS和JavaScript来构建个性化的小程序,并在百度搜索和其他产品中进行展示。在本篇文章中,我将向你详细介绍百度小程序的开发原理以及如何使用源码进行开发。

一、百度小程序开发原理

1. 小程序框架:百度小程序采用MVVM(Model-View-ViewModel)框架来进行开发。它将页面分为WXML(类似于HTML)、WXSS(类似于CSS)和JS三个文件,实现了视图层和逻辑层的分离。开发者可以在WXML中描述页面结构,在WXSS中定义样式,在JS文件中编写页面逻辑。

2. 百度开放能力:百度小程序内置了丰富的开放能力,包括地图、搜索、语音识别、推送等功能。这些开放能力可以通过调用百度开放平台提供的API来实现。开发者可以在小程序代码中使用API的接口,来实现各种功能需求。

3. 数据绑定和事件处理:百度小程序支持双向数据绑定,开发者只需在JS文件中绑定数据,当数据变化时,页面上相应的内容会自动更新。此外,开发者可以给页面元素绑定各种事件处理函数,如点击事件、滑动事件等,来实现用户交互。

4. 生命周期管理:百度小程序提供了丰富的生命周期函数,包括onLoad、onShow、onHide等。开发者可以在这些生命周期函数中编写相应的逻辑代码,来管理小程序的页面生命周期。

二、百度小程序开发源码的使用

如果你想快速开发一款百度小程序,你可以考虑使用开源的小程序框架或者模板来加速开发过程。下面是使用百度小程序开发源码的一般步骤:

1. 下载并安装开发工具:首先,你需要下载并安装百度小程序开发工具,它是一个集成了开发环境、调试工具和模拟器的工具包。

2. 创建小程序项目:打开小程序开发工具,点击新建项目,填写项目名称和项目目录。选择合适的模板或者空白项目,点击确定创建项目。

3. 编写代码:在小程序开发工具中,你可以看到生成的项目结构,包含了WXML、WXSS和JS文件。你可以根据需求在这些文件中编写代码,实现你想要的功能。

4. 调试和预览:在开发过程中,你可以通过小程序开发工具提供的调试功能来查看代码的执行情况。你可以在模拟器中预览小程序的效果,并进行调试和优化。

5. 发布小程序:当你完成开发并测试通过后,你可以选择发布小程序。选择合适的发布方式,填写相关信息,并提交审核。一旦审核通过,你的小程序就可以在百度搜索和其他产品中展示。

总结:

百度小程序开发源码的出售可以帮助开发者快速入门和开发。在了解百度小程序的开发原理后,你可以使用开源的小程序框架或者模板来加速开发过程。希望这篇文章能对你有所帮助,祝你在百度小程序的开发之旅中取得成功!


相关知识:
百度小程序开发不能预览
百度小程序是一种基于百度智能小程序开发框架的应用程序,可以在百度搜索引擎和百度App中进行搜索和使用。在进行百度小程序开发时,我们通常会使用百度小程序开发工具进行项目的创建、代码编写和调试。然而,与其他小程序开发工具不同的是,百度小程序开发工具目前不支持实
2023-08-23
怎么用模板开发百度小程程序
开发百度小程序的过程中,使用模板是一种非常常见的方式。模板可以减少开发的工作量,提高开发效率,并帮助开发人员快速构建小程序。本文将为您介绍使用模板进行百度小程序开发的原理和详细步骤。**1. 理解模板**首先,让我们来了解一下什么是模板。在百度小程序开发中
2023-08-23
安达电商小程序开发
安达电商小程序是一款基于微信平台的应用程序,为企业提供一种全新的销售渠道和客户服务。本文将从小程序的定义、原理、开发流程以及实现方式等多个方面对其进行详细介绍。一、小程序的定义小程序是一种轻量级应用,可以在微信内直接运行,用户不需要下载安装,可以随时随地进
2023-08-09
安康小程序开发外包收费标准
随着互联网技术的不断升级和普及,小程序作为一种新的应用形态,被越来越多的企业所看好和采用。而对于一些小型企业或个人,由于缺乏开发技术和人力资源,选择外包小程序开发成为了较为普遍的选择。那么,安康小程序开发外包的收费标准是怎样的呢?一、小程序开发的定价方式小
2023-08-09
php可以开发小程序不开发吗
PHP本身是一种服务器端脚本语言,可以用于动态生成网页内容。而小程序则是一种基于微信或其他平台的应用程序,通常需要使用专门的开发工具和语言进行开发,例如微信小程序需要使用小程序原生框架(WXML、WXSS和JavaScript)进行开发。虽然PHP本身无法
2023-08-09
dva搭建小程序开发环境
Dva是一个基于React和Redux的框架,它用于快速开发Web应用程序。不仅如此,Dva还可以在小程序开发中应用。在本篇文章中,我们将会介绍如何使用Dva构建小程序应用。## Dva的简介Dva是一个基于React和Redux的轻量级框架,专门用于快速
2023-08-09
console面板是小程序开发工具吗
在小程序开发中,console面板是一个非常重要的开发工具。它的作用不仅限于调试与排错,还可以进行算法优化、性能分析、错误监测等操作。console面板是一个能够在开发工具中显示出来的调试工具,可以为开发者提供一系列的帮助,使得开发调试过程更加容易。它包含
2023-08-09
app软件小程序开发
随着智能手机和互联网技术的普及,移动应用程序越来越受到人们的关注和欢迎。其中,APP(Application)、软件和小程序成为了人们日常生活中必不可少的工具。那么,APP、软件和小程序分别是什么?它们有何不同点?它们又是如何进行开发的?下面来一一解析。一
2023-08-09
java代码怎么生成exe
Java 是一种跨平台的编程语言,它的代码在编译后生成 .class 文件,然后在 Java 虚拟机(JVM)上运行。这意味着 Java 应用程序不直接编译成可执行文件(.exe 文件),而是依赖于安装在计算机上的 JVM。不过,有些情况下,我们希望将 J
2023-05-26
小程序开发工具联系方式怎么改
小程序开发工具是微信提供的一款开发工具,它可以帮助开发者快速开发小程序,并提供各种方便的功能,比如实时调试、代码自动补全、调试日志输出等。同时,小程序开发工具也支持添加插件和组件,扩展开发者的功能。小程序开发工具可以通过更新来获取最新版本。如果您使用的是W
2023-05-26
微信小程序开发工具网易云小程序代码怎么用
微信小程序是一种轻量级的应用程序,它可以在微信中运行,不需要下载安装,用户可以随时打开使用。网易云小程序是一款音乐播放器应用程序,用户可以通过网易云小程序在线听歌、收藏音乐歌单等。本文将详细介绍网易云小程序的代码用法。网易云小程序的代码是使用微信小程序开发
2023-05-26
微信小程序开发工具卡顿
微信小程序是一种轻量级的应用程序,在应用程序的开发阶段,开发者需要使用微信小程序开发工具进行开发。微信小程序开发工具是一款基于Electron框架开发的跨平台开发工具,具有可视化界面、代码自动提交、实时预览等优点。然而,在开发过程中,有时候会出现卡顿问题,
2023-05-26